EDITION 2022

NOVEMBER 9 - 13

In its eleventh edition, the Los Cabos International Film Festival returned to physical spaces through the unparalleled collective experience that cinema offers. This year, we presented an unmissable program that the audience could enjoy at Cinemex Puerto Paraíso, as well as in other outdoor spaces: Once Once and the Civic Plaza of La Playa Community. During the festival, the Sin Fronteras Award was presented to Mexican actor Tenoch Huerta, and the Mujeres Fantásticas award was given to actress and producer Karla Souza. This edition also celebrated the return of our Industry activities to a fully in-person edition, through three main programs: the Gabriel Figueroa Film Fund, the Meet-Mart, and a Panel Program: New Cinema Signals and Ephemeral Stories: Cinema Facing New Audiences. Additionally, this year, as a follow-up to the premieres of national films that have been part of the Gabriel Figueroa Film Fund, a new section was added: Encuadres Mexicanos.

  • MUJERES FANTÁSTICAS AWARD TO KARLA SOUZA

     

    Mexican actress and producer. This year, we continued the Mujeres Fantásticas initiative, which promotes the recognition and visibility of women's work in the film industry. We awarded this distinction to actress and producer Karla Souza, who has emerged as a brave voice denouncing abuse against women within and outside the film industry; and whose work has placed her in some of the most important projects in the cinema and television industries in the United States.

    SIN FRONTERAS AWARD TO TENOCH HUERTA

     

    Mexican actor and producer. For his outstanding career and tireless work in favor of inclusion, diversity, and the visibility of Latin American talent in the global film industry, the Los Cabos International Film Festival honored Tenoch Huerta with the Sin Fronteras Award during its Opening Gala. As part of this tribute, Días de Gracia and Güeros were showcased, the latter of which won the Los Cabos Competition Award in 2014.

    CHRISTMAS SHORT FILM COMPETITION (in collaboration with Studio Universal)
    The Los Cabos International Film Festival presented the second edition of the Christmas Short Film Competition, in collaboration with NBCUniversal International Networks through its specialized cinema channel, Studio Universal.
